无论是金融、医疗、教育还是零售等行业,数据的安全性和完整性直接关系到企业的运营效率和市场竞争力
数据库作为数据存储和管理的核心系统,其备份工作的重要性不言而喻
然而,在实际操作中,一些企业或个人出于种种原因,试图在数据库备份过程中关闭数据库,这种做法无疑是对数据安全与业务连续性的一大威胁
本文将深入探讨为何数据库备份时不能关闭,并阐述其对企业运营和数据安全的重要意义
一、数据库备份的重要性 数据库备份是指将数据库中的数据复制到另一个存储介质或位置,以防止数据丢失或损坏
它是数据保护和灾难恢复策略的重要组成部分
当数据库发生意外故障、人为错误、病毒攻击或自然灾害等情况时,备份的数据可以迅速恢复,确保企业业务的连续性和数据的完整性
1.数据恢复:备份是数据恢复的基础
一旦数据库出现问题,备份的数据可以迅速恢复,减少数据丢失的风险
2.灾难恢复:在自然灾害或人为灾难导致数据丢失的情况下,备份数据是恢复业务的关键
3.合规性:许多行业法规要求企业保留特定时间段内的数据备份,以确保数据的可追溯性和合规性
4.测试和开发:备份数据还可以用于测试和开发环境,以减少对生产环境的影响
二、为何数据库备份时不能关闭 数据库备份时不能关闭,这一原则基于以下几个关键原因: 1.数据一致性:数据库在运行过程中,数据是不断变化的
如果关闭数据库进行备份,可能会导致数据的不一致性,即备份的数据与实际数据存在差异
这种差异可能导致数据恢复后的业务逻辑错误或数据丢失
因此,保持数据库在备份过程中的运行状态,可以确保备份的数据与实际数据保持一致
2.业务连续性:关闭数据库进行备份会中断企业的正常业务操作
对于依赖数据库进行业务处理的企业来说,这种中断可能导致业务停滞、客户满意度下降甚至经济损失
而保持数据库在备份过程中的运行状态,可以确保企业业务的连续性,避免因备份工作而引发的业务中断
3.备份效率:关闭数据库进行备份往往需要更长的时间,因为需要在关闭前完成所有未完成的事务和数据处理
而保持数据库在备份过程中的运行状态,可以利用数据库的在线备份功能,实现增量备份或差异备份,提高备份效率并减少备份时间
4.安全性:关闭数据库进行备份可能会增加安全风险
在关闭数据库期间,如果系统受到攻击或出现故障,可能会导致数据的永久丢失
而保持数据库在备份过程中的运行状态,可以利用数据库的日志和事务管理机制,确保数据的完整性和安全性
三、实现数据库备份时保持运行的方法 为了确保数据库备份时保持运行状态,企业可以采取以下措施: 1.在线备份技术:利用数据库的在线备份功能,如Oracle的RMAN(Recovery Manager)或MySQL的mysqldump工具中的--single-transaction选项,可以在不关闭数据库的情况下进行备份
这些技术通过锁定数据库中的特定表或事务,确保备份过程中数据的一致性
2.增量备份与差异备份:与传统的全量备份相比,增量备份和差异备份只备份自上次备份以来发生变化的数据
这种方法可以显著减少备份时间和存储空间的占用,同时保持数据库在备份过程中的运行状态
3.备份策略优化:根据企业的业务需求和数据库的变化频率,制定合理的备份策略
例如,可以设定每天的低峰时段进行备份,以减少对业务的影响;同时,可以定期对备份数据进行测试,确保其可用性和完整性
4.监控与报警:建立数据库备份的监控和报警系统,实时跟踪备份进度和状态
一旦发现备份异常或失败,立即触发报警并采取相应的措施,确保备份工作的顺利进行
5.培训与意识提升:加强对企业员工的培训,提高他们对数据库备份重要性的认识
通过定期的培训和演练,增强员工的备份意识和操作技能,确保备份工作的规范性和有效性
四、案例分析:备份中断带来的后果 以下是一个因备份中断而引发严重后果的案例: 某金融企业在进行数据库备份时,由于操作失误导致数据库意外关闭
由于备份过程中数据库未保持运行状态,备份的数据与实际数据存在差异
当企业发现这一问题并尝试恢复数据时,发现备份数据无法完全恢复业务
最终,该企业不得不花费大量时间和资金从其他渠道获取缺失的数据,并修复因数据不一致而引发的业务问题
这一事件不仅给企业带来了巨大的经济损失,还严重影响了企业的声誉和客户信任度
五、结论 综上所述,数据库备份时不能关闭是确保数据安全与业务连续性的关键
关闭数据库进行备份可能导致数据不一致性、业务中断、备份效率低下以及安全风险增加等问题
为了保持数据库在备份过程中的运行状态,企业可以采取在线备份技术、增量备份与差异备份、备份策略优化、监控与报警以及培训与意识提升等措施
通过这些措施的实施,企业可以确保数据库备份的顺利进行,为企业的数据安全和业务连续性提供有力保障
在未来的发展中,随着技术的不断进步和业务的日益复杂,数据库备份工作将面临更多的挑战和机遇
企业应持续关注备份技术的发展动态,不断优化备份策略和方法,以适应不断变化的市场环境和业务需求
同时,加强员工的培训和意识提升工作,确保备份工作的规范性和有效性,为企业的可持续发展奠定坚实的数据基础